我是Docker的新手,想知道为什么这么多docker-compose映射端口的示例从内部到外部,而不仅仅是保持相同。例如,我看到一个postgres示例,映射为4612:5432。
人们不只是保留它5432:5432是有原因的吗?
最佳答案
可能有不同的原因而不是映射到主机上的同一端口:这样做可以使多个Postgres在单独的端口上运行,并对它们进行调整,以防由于某些原因您想要在DEV / PROD中使用不同的端口。
关于docker - Docker:内部端口,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/55484560/